DebugMessageBox

ClubCrawler.DOMUserInterface. DebugMessageBox

Contains displayed debug messages created by dataManager.log when dataManager.debug.on is true.

Constructor

new DebugMessageBox(container)

Source:
Parameters:
Name Type Description
container HTMLElement

The DOM container element.

Members

debugObject :ClubCrawler.Types.DebugConfig

Source:

The debug settings object to reference.

Type:

element :HTMLElement

Source:

The DOM container element.

Type:
  • HTMLElement

messages :Array

Source:

The debug message elements.

Type:
  • Array

Methods

deleteMessage(debugMessage)

Source:

Deletes a message from debug lines when the "x" on a message is clicked, then calls updateDebugMessages.

Parameters:
Name Type Description
debugMessage ClubCrawler.UserInterface.DebugMessage

The message to delete.

loadDebugObject()

Source:
Properties:
Type Description
ClubCrawler.Types.DebugConfig

The global debug settings object.

Loads the debug object. Adds listeners to debug.emitter for changes to debug.debugLines.

Listens to Events:

updateDebugMessages()

Source:

Updates debug messages.

Also deletes extra messages which are larger than max debug lines.

Listens to Events: